Recently got an Autel Evo Lite 640T drone. Also have done some track updates this year and have not ever had an aerial photo of the layout. It is exactly 1/2 mile around one lap. Upper section is mostly a turn track with a 45' table top in the middle. Lower section consists of a 67' double, a step down, 5 table tops , and a rhythm section down the bottom straight. Takes just under 2 mins per lap for me on my 250SX. I had some good riders come down to practice over the last couple of years. Its not real challenging , but its a serious workout with the tight technical sections. It was dry and dusty last week when i flew the drone. The dirt is black when it is wet and prepped. How did you come up with the track layout btw? Was there a plan for it, winging it as you went, or you rode on the property enough to develop the flow?
I took years of riding all the tracks around the southeast and thought about what attributes I liked and what I didnt like. Then I saw 100's of Youtube videos and training videos. All had turn tracks mentioned. Built the track and then changed it and had a LOT of dirt brought in. Finally got it the way it will probably stay this past spring. It seems to flow pretty well now.
